DRAYTON WWTP EFFLUENT QUALITY MANAGEMENT
MUNICIPAL CLASS ENVIRONMENTAL ASSESSMENT (EA)


NOTICE OF PUBLIC INFORMATION CENTRE


The Township of Mapleton is studying the problem of meeting effluent quality requirements during approved discharge periods at the Drayton Wastewater Treatment Plant (WWTP).  These problems have resulted in suspensions of effluent discharge and subsequent emergency discharges in the past.  The Township has engaged in a Municipal Class Environmental Assessment to identify a preferred option for ensuring that wastewater effluent is consistently acceptable for discharge throughout the approved discharge periods.


This project has been planned as a Schedule B project under the Municipal Class Environmental Assessment.  A Public Information Centre has been scheduled to provide all interested parties with background information on the study, and to discuss the project.  The Public Information Centre will be held on:

NOTICE OF A PUBLIC MEETING FOR AN AMENDMENT
TO THE MAPLETON ZONING BY-LAW & NOTICE OF COMPLETE APPLICATION - ZBA 2010-11 (ABRAM & MARY BOWMAN)


TAKE NOTICE that the Council of the Corporation of the Township of Mapleton has received a complete application to consider a proposed amendment to the Comprehensive Zoning By-law 2000-84, pursuant to Section 34 of the Planning Act, R.S.O. 1990, as amended. 


PUBLIC MEETING Mapleton Council will consider this application at their meeting scheduled for:


Tuesday, August 10, 2010 at 7:00 p.m.
Mapleton Township Municipal Offices
Council Chambers, 7275 Sideroad 16


THE SUBJECT LAND is legally described as Concession 2 E, Part Lot 7, Township of Mapleton and is municipally known as 8450 Concession 3. There is a dwelling, kennel and outbuildings on the 40 ha (100 ac) farm parcel.  The property is currently in a site specific Agricultural zone (25.1.320) permitting a dog kennel in addition to those uses permitted in an Agricultural zone. 


THE PURPOSE AND EFFECT of the application is to amend the existing site specific zone on the property to allow an increase in the size of the kennel building(s) and to increase the number of dogs from 20 to 25.


MAKING AN ORAL OR WRITTEN SUBMISSION
Any person or public body is entitled to attend the public meeting and make written or oral submissions on the proposed zoning by-law amendment.


If a person or public body does not make oral submissions at a public meeting or make written submissions to the Township of Mapleton before the by-law is passed, the person or public body is not entitled to appeal the decision of the Council of the Township of Mapleton to the Ontario Municipal Board.


If a person or public body does not make oral submissions at a public meeting, or make written submissions to the Township of Mapleton before the by-law is passed, the person or public body may not be added as a party to the hearing of an appeal before the Ontario Municipal Board unless, in the opinion of the Board, there are reasonable grounds to do so.
